My dance students are so energetic. They give me energy that last throughout the whole day. I am a Theatre Arts teacher who became certified in dance and taught my first beginner tap and jazz class last year. I had a wonderful time teaching and engaging those awesome and new students!
They were enthusiastic about learning tap and jazz, and they made each day enjoyable to teach.
Unfortunately, only half were able to purchase their much needed tap shoes, but even without the proper foot wear they genuinely tried to learn the steps. We made it through the year because of their willingness to keep trying!
My Project
Having proper foot wear in a tap class makes ALL the difference. Without the tap shoes, my students couldn't know for sure if they were making the proper sounds while they danced. They could mimic the dance moves but neither I nor they could tell if they were actually creating the sounds that their classmates, with tap shoes, were making. Out of the 15 dancers in my class, only 7 were able to purchase their tap shoes. The students without tap shoe still did their best, but the experience was not the same. With a collection of tap shoe on hand in class, no one will ever have to dance without proper foot wear.
